Why Population Services International (PSI)? We’re Population Services International (better known as “PSI”), a global health non-profit. We aim to make it easier for people in the developing world to be healthy by marketing affordable health products and services (think mosquito nets, HIV testing and more) through private sector strategies. We are a $560m enterprise based in Washington, DC, operating in the private and public sectors in more than 65 countries. Most of our brands have dominant market shares that are the backbone for their health category. Check out www.psi.org for more information on our programs.

PSI Somaliland is the prime recipient and implementer for two large scale DFID grants in Somaliland/ Somalia. We also manage our portfolio through implementing NGO partners who help us implement this program across Somalia
